Everllence and Hudong-Zhonghua to Design 180,000 cbm LNG Carrier

Everllence has signed an engineering design agreement with Hudong-Zhonghua Shipbuilding Group, the state-owned Shanghai builder, covering the development of a 180,000 cubic metre class LNG carrier with a dual-fuel electric propulsion system.

The two parties frame the work against tightening IMO carbon intensity requirements, and see scope to make LNG shipping both cleaner and more efficient as those thresholds move. The partners have collaborated before, delivering 10 conventional dual-fuel diesel electric LNG carriers.

The agreement was signed on June 5, 2026 by Yang Chunhua, technical centre deputy director of Hudong-Zhonghua, with Pan Ke, head of sales and projects for four-stroke China, representing Everllence.

"Decarbonisation is an obvious development trend in the shipping industry. Ship owners are currently faced with unprecedented challenges and uncertainties as they are fighting to achieve the GHG Net Zero Emissions by 2050. We are very glad to work together with Everllence to develop the hybrid-electric propulsion solution with high efficiency on LNG carriers, which shall provide more options for ship owners," said Song Wei, chief technical engineer of Hudong-Zhonghua.

Dominik Thoma, global manager LNG cargo at Everllence, set out the case for working across the yard and engine boundary rather than within it. "Nowadays, individual technology providers can only achieve marginal efficiency improvements. Accordingly, for bigger gains, shipyards and engine manufacturers need to work closely together. Hudong-Zhonghua as a market leader within the construction of LNG Carriers and Everllence as market leader in the design and manufacture of four-stroke engines possess the joint capabilities to bring propulsion systems to the next level."

The size class matters as much as the propulsion choice. At 180,000 cubic metres the design sits in the mainstream of the LNG carrier orderbook, which means an efficiency gain established here carries across a large share of future tonnage rather than a niche.
